What is Officevibe?

Simple, Affordable, Effective

Officevibe — rebranded under the Workleap umbrella in 2023 — is the employee engagement tool for companies that want the fundamentals done well without paying enterprise prices. Founded in Montreal in 2012, it serves over 8,000 organizations. The philosophy is refreshingly modest: send short, frequent surveys, give managers clear data, and make anonymous feedback easy. That's it. And for most teams under 500 people, that's enough.

The Pulse Survey Approach

Every week, employees receive 5 questions covering 10 engagement metrics. Each question takes 30 seconds to answer. Response rates typically run 80-90% — far higher than traditional annual surveys — because the time commitment is trivial. Over time, the data builds a trend line that shows whether engagement is improving or declining without the drama of a big annual survey event.

Anonymous Feedback Done Right

The anonymous feedback channel is one of Officevibe's best features. Employees can submit feedback at any time, and managers see it without knowing who sent it. Managers can respond, creating a dialogue where the employee stays anonymous. This actually works in practice — employees share things they'd never say in a meeting or attributed survey. The trust-building takes time, but once established, it becomes a valuable signal channel.

Manager Dashboard

Managers get a simple dashboard showing their team's engagement across 10 metrics, with comparisons to company average and trend arrows. It's not sophisticated analytics — no driver analysis or attrition prediction — but it tells a manager whether their team is doing okay and where to focus attention. The simplicity is the feature. Managers who wouldn't spend 20 minutes in Culture Amp's analytics will spend 3 minutes in Officevibe's dashboard.

Pros and Cons

Pros

  • At $3.50/person/month, roughly half the cost of Culture Amp or Lattice for engagement
  • Automated weekly pulse surveys achieve 80-90% response rates due to minimal time commitment
  • Anonymous feedback channel with manager dialogue is well-designed and actually gets used
  • Simple manager dashboards that busy managers will actually look at every week
  • Free tier lets you try the platform with one team before committing

Cons

  • Analytics are basic — no driver analysis, attrition prediction, or deep segmentation
  • No performance management, reviews, or goal tracking — engagement surveys only
  • Benchmarking is limited compared to Culture Amp or Lattice industry datasets
  • Customization options for surveys and reports are more limited than premium tools
  • Better suited for teams under 500 — larger organizations may outgrow the simplicity

Officevibe is now part of Workleap, a suite of workplace tools that also includes Sharegate and Pingboard. The Officevibe product continues as the employee engagement component. The rebrand happened in 2023 but the core product functionality remains the same.

There's a free tier for one team with basic features. The Essential plan is $3.50/person/month and covers most needs. The Pro plan at $5/person/month adds custom surveys and integrations. Annual billing saves 15%. For a 200-person company on Essential, that's about $700/month.
